What Is a Facebook Text Overlay Checker

A Facebook text overlay checker is a pre-launch compliance tool for advertisers. Facebook limits how much text can appear in ad images because data shows that visually-driven creatives outperform text-heavy ones. The platform does not outright reject high-text images anymore, but it significantly reduces their delivery, which means fewer impressions and higher costs.

The checker works by applying a grid over your uploaded image and determining what percentage of grid cells contain text. It classifies results into tiers: low text (full delivery), medium text (reduced delivery), and high text (severely limited delivery). This mirrors the evaluation Facebook performs internally when processing your ad creative.

Knowing your classification before launching lets you redesign proactively. Move messaging from the image to the ad copy fields, reduce font sizes, or simplify overlays to bring text density down. The tool functions as quality assurance for your creative workflow. How To Use the Facebook Text Overlay Checker

Upload the image you plan to use as ad creative. The tool accepts JPG and PNG formats. After processing, it returns a visual indicator of text coverage and a classification (low, medium, or high).

If the result shows medium or high text, revise your design. Effective strategies include moving headlines to the ad’s primary text or headline fields, using a smaller logo, eliminating decorative text that does not add information, or cropping the image to include more visual space.

Upload the revised version and verify it now falls in the low-text category. Repeat until compliance is confirmed. This iterative approach is faster than discovering delivery issues after your campaign is already consuming budget.

When To Use This Tool

Run every ad image through the checker as part of your creative approval process. This applies to all placements: feed ads, Stories, Reels covers, carousel cards, and video thumbnails. Each visual element Facebook displays as part of your ad undergoes its own text evaluation.

Design agencies delivering assets to clients should include overlay compliance as a standard quality check. In-house creative teams building asset libraries benefit from flagging non-compliant designs before they enter the scheduling queue. E-commerce brands running sale promotions with price overlays especially need to validate since numerical text counts toward the ratio.

FAQ

How does the text overlay checker evaluate images?

It divides the image into grid sections and identifies which cells contain text. The percentage of text-occupied cells determines whether your image falls into low, medium, or high text categories, each with different delivery implications.

What happens if my image has too much text?

Facebook reduces ad delivery for high-text images. Your campaign may still run, but it reaches fewer people and costs more per result than a compliant creative with minimal text overlay would achieve.

Do logos count as text in the overlay check?

Yes. Text within logos, watermarks, and brand marks all count toward the overall text ratio. Consider using icon-only or wordmark-free logo versions specifically for ad images to keep text density low.

Can I check video thumbnails with this tool?

Yes. Export the thumbnail as a static image and upload it to the checker. Facebook evaluates video thumbnails using the same text overlay criteria it applies to static ad images for delivery decisions.
